Median Household Income

The unemployment rate in Riverdale, GA, is 11.90%, with job growth of -0.18%. Future job growth over the next ten years is predicted to be 27.74%.

Riverdale, GA Taxes

Riverdale, GA,sales tax rate is 7.00%. Income tax is 6.00%.

Riverdale, GA Income and Salaries

The income per capita is $16,175, which includes all adults and children. The median household income is $41,105.
